Time Limits

In many states, asbestos patients are given a limited time to file a mesothelioma suit. These laws are known as statutes of limitation and they set deadlines to file an individual injury claim or wrongful death lawsuit. A mesothelioma attorney can help families and patients determine the time limit that applies to their case. The applicable statute can depend on a range of factors, including the victim's places of residence and work. It could also differ based on the place where the asbestos exposure occurred, and which asbestos companies or work sites are involved.

The "clock" of the statute of limitations typically starts when an individual knew or should have been aware that exposure to asbestos caused a serious injury. In mesothelioma cases, this is typically the date that a diagnosis is made. In certain instances the clock could begin earlier. For example in the case of a chronic condition like asthma that requires constant medication and limits their activities, the clock could start earlier.

If a mesothelioma patient or their family member passes away before the statute of limitations has expired, their estate can still pursue a wrongful death lawsuit seeking compensation from responsible parties. These claims are usually paid to cover funeral expenses along with lost income as well as past pain and suffering.

A national mesothelioma attorney can assist you in filing claims for compensation through the asbestos trust fund. Asbestos companies that are responsible for asbestos exposure were reorganized by Chapter 11 bankruptcy laws and created trusts to pay mesothelioma patients. A mesothelioma attorney with experience can provide you with a list of these trusts and assist you in filing for compensation.
